Output 3dbc654693669821058599e04e5842f6f350ecf6d86c841e2b58633734befdd2:1

value
20606
script pubkey
OP_0 OP_PUSHBYTES_32 e473d33f471f2f2834fe395aeb76af4ffd54dab24eaa62171e52def07eb1bd91
address
bc1qu3eax068ruhjsd8789dwka40fl74fk4jf64xy9c72t00ql43hkgs0uclwg
transaction
3dbc654693669821058599e04e5842f6f350ecf6d86c841e2b58633734befdd2